Hyper launches new color-matching USB-C hubs for iMacs M1

Hyper today announced the launch of a set of HyperDrive USB-C hubs designed for Apple’s 24-inch M1 iMacs, and the hubs are unique in that they come with front plates available in every iMac color.

The HyperDrive 5-in-1 hub includes two 5GB / s USB-C data ports, two 5GB / s USB-A data ports, and a 5GB / s USB-A port that also offers a charge of 7.5 W for small devices. It is priced at $ 50.

The HyperDrive 6-in-1 hub has a more varied assortment of ports for those who need connectivity beyond USB. There is a 4K 60Hz HDMI port, a microSD card slot, an SD card slot, a 10Gb / s USB-C data port, a 10Gb / USB USB-A data port and a USB-A data port 10Gb / s which also offers 7.5W load. The 6-in-1 USB-C hub is priced at $ 80.

Each hub is approximately 5 inches long and 1.5 inches wide and is designed to be attached to the front of the iMac using one of the rear USB-C ports. The hubs are sold with seven matching color faceplates so you can choose the one that works with your MiMac‌.
